專利名稱: | 可編程通用多核處理器芯片上處理器之間程序流同步方法 |
專利類別: | |
申請?zhí)?/strong>: | 200510086643.3 |
申請日期: | 2005-10-20 |
專利號: | CN1952900 |
第一發(fā)明人: | 周朝顯 陳 杰 |
其它發(fā)明人: | |
國外申請日期: | |
國外申請方式: | |
專利授權(quán)日期: | |
繳費情況: | |
實施情況: | |
專利證書號: | |
專利摘要: | 一種多核處理器芯片上處理器之間進行程序流同步的方法。在多核 處理器芯片上,兩個處理器核需要通過接口動態(tài)數(shù)據(jù)和控制信息交換。 發(fā)送的處理器必須在接收的處理器做好準備之后,開始發(fā)送不會出錯。 二者之間需要同步,該方法:執(zhí)行同步指令,該指令將發(fā)往另一方的一 根同步信號有效,并使本處理器進入閑置等待狀態(tài),直到發(fā)現(xiàn)對方發(fā)來 的同步信號有效,才繼續(xù)程序流執(zhí)行;另一方也在做好準備時,執(zhí)行同 步指令,同樣進行閑置等待狀態(tài),一旦發(fā)現(xiàn)對方發(fā)來的同步信號有效, 就繼續(xù)自己的程序流,進行信息交換。該方法解決了處理器核之間進行 同步的難點,而且易于編程,同步時,由于處理器核處于閑置等待狀態(tài), 核內(nèi)邏輯不翻轉(zhuǎn),極大的降低了功耗。 |
其它備注: | |
科研產(chǎn)出